@ericvannostrand.bsky.social & I are in @briefingbook.bsky.social on infrastructure. Last week, @jasonfurman.bsky.social argued that real US infrastructure investment has fallen since the pandemic. Eric & I find however that using BEA’s deflator, real highway spending is up 11% since 2019. 1/11

"Native-born Americans consume, on an average per capita basis, more welfare and entitlement benefits than all immigrants, and this pattern has held for several years across data from multiple datasets analyzed with different methods" www.cato.org/briefing-pap...
